Two weeks post HT
All looks well, all scabs are gone and I’m careful washing the top by patting on the baby shampoo to get it foamy and then with my finger tips only gently messaging the top, sides I’m being a little more rough. Seeing 10-15 hairs in the shower not sure if it’s shedding yet or just me losing hair. Can definitely see alot of the grafted hairs have grown and a few haven’t, hopefully they are just slow growers. 
Top to mid scalp is still numb, donor area is still a little sensitive but it’s getting better each day and not as itchy.

4 weeks post HT. (9 days since my haircut)
Top of head is still slightly numb, getting better as the weeks go by. Still itchy sometimes mainly on the donor. Have been shedding a lot the last week. Been trying not to rub my head too aggressively as that just causes more to fall out. Don’t think I have any shock loss yet.
Not looking forward to the next few months.
